How do you change the battery with a spare key?
There's nothing worse than finding that the battery on your key fob failed and you are unable to unlock your car. Fortunately, it's easy to replace the battery and save some money at the dealer.
The first step is to press the auxiliary key button that is located on the back of the key fob. This will release the key made of metal and reveal two slots on the opposite side of the case. Press the flathead into one of these slots and then gently pull the two halves of the case apart. When the battery is completely exposed, take it out and put it away somewhere you won't forget it.
Be sure to bring an extra battery in place prior to starting. These batteries can be purchased from any store that sells batteries or from a replacement mazda key fob dealer in Winter Garden. Using the right type of battery will ensure that your key fob is working correctly.
Replace the cap on the battery, and then insert the new battery. Be careful not to damage the small rubber ring that the battery rests on. Then press the two halves of the key fob until you hear an audible click.
